Has any hurlers out there found it difficult getting their hands on decent hurls for a reasonable price? Our club has up to this year bought a supply in bulk, and we just bought them off the club at a subsidised price. They say can no longer do this, and have put the onus on the players to get their own hurls, which is fair enough in the present climate. I haven't bought directly from a hurley maker in years, and was wondering what the score is with supply and price given te ashback disease scare.

We have all been here before with disappointing performances with the county footballers but they can turn it around. Remember it was a Division 4 team that knocked us out of the championship last year and the team was

Chris Kerr; Anto Healy, Ricky Johnston, KEvin O'Boyle; Tony Scullion, Justin Crozier, James Loughrey; Michael McCann, Conal Kelly; Conor Murray, Mark Sweeney, Kevin Niblock; Tomás McCann, Owen Gallagher, Marty Johnston

Our early season form was very good and we were playing an attacking brand of football. Up until the Roscommon game we were in the hunt for promotion and to be fair after that we were playing the two teams that have been promoted.

We should have a degree of realism in our assessment of the football team and our players. There will be good days ahead again I hope!
